Harnessing the Power of Regeneration
At the heart of ActionPower‘s Regenerative Grid Simulator is the company’s innovative PRE20 series – a full 4-quadrant, fully regenerative AC power source designed for a wide range of electrical power testing scenarios. These advanced units are capable of seamlessly simulating both source and load conditions, enabling power engineers to accurately mimic real-world grid conditions and evaluate the performance of their devices under a variety of challenging scenarios.

Tailored for Power Electronics and Energy Systems
ActionPower’s Regenerative Grid Simulator is particularly well-suited for the testing of power electronics and energy systems, such as photovoltaic (PV) inverters, power conversion systems (PCS), and online uninterruptible power supplies (UPS). Seamless Power Flow Management
One of the standout features of the Regenerative Grid Simulator is its ability to seamlessly manage power flow. In cases where the unit under test (UUT) generates excess current, the Regenerative Grid Simulator’s detection circuit senses the excess power and automatically feeds it back to the grid, ensuring a smooth and efficient power exchange.
